1. Basic ingredients of Maocai soup base

Making Maocai soup base requires the following basic ingredients, which can be adjusted according to personal taste:
| Material | Dosage | Remarks |
|---|---|---|
| butter | 200g | Vegetable oil can also be substituted |
| Doubanjiang | 50g | It is recommended to use Pixian Doubanjiang |
| dried chili pepper | 30g | Adjust according to spiciness |
| Zanthoxylum bungeanum | 10 grams | It is recommended to use Sichuan peppercorns |
| ginger | 20g | slice |
| garlic | 20g | Beat to pieces |
| star anise | 3 pieces | Add flavor |
| Geranium leaves | 2 pieces | Add flavor |
| stock | 1000ml | Can be replaced with water |
2. Preparation steps of maocai soup base
The following are the detailed steps for making Maocai soup base:
1.Stir-fried spices: Put butter into a pot, heat over low heat until melted, add bean paste, dried chili pepper, Sichuan peppercorns, ginger, garlic, star anise and bay leaves, stir-fry until fragrant.
2.Add stock: Pour the fried spices into the soup stock, bring to a boil over high heat, then turn to low heat and simmer for 30 minutes to allow the aroma to fully blend into the soup.
3.Strain the soup base: Strain the cooked soup base through a strainer to remove impurities and keep the clear soup base.
4.seasoning: Add salt, chicken essence, pepper and other seasonings according to personal taste to adjust the saltiness of the soup base.
3. Frequently Asked Questions about Maocai Soup Base
The following are common problems and solutions you may encounter when making Maocai soup base:
| question | Reason |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| The soup base is not rich enough | Insufficient cooking time for spices or insufficient soup concentration | Increase the spice sauté time or use a thicker stock |
| The soup base is too greasy | Too much butter | Reduce the amount of butter or use vegetable oil to replace part of the butter |
| The soup base is too spicy | Too much dried chili pepper | Reduce the amount of dried chili peppers or choose less spicy chili peppers |
4. Suggestions on matching Maocai soup base
Maocai soup base can be paired with a variety of ingredients. Here are some common pairing suggestions:
1.Vegetables: Cabbage, bean sprouts, potato slices, lotus root slices, etc.
2.meat: Beef slices, mutton slices, lunch meat, etc.
3.Soy products: Tofu, tofu skin, yuba, etc.
4.Seafood: Shrimp, fish balls, crab sticks, etc.
